15/05/2015: notas da versão do Apigee Edge

Você está vendo a documentação do Apigee Edge.
Consulte a documentação do Apigee X.

Na terça-feira, 21 de abril de 2015, lançamos uma nova versão do Apigee Edge.

Em caso de dúvidas, acesse o Suporte ao Cliente da Apigee.

Para uma lista de todas as notas de versão do Apigee Edge, consulte Notas de lançamento do Apigee.

Novos recursos e melhorias

Veja a seguir os novos recursos e melhorias desta versão.

Suporte a indicação de nome do servidor (SNI, na sigla em inglês)

O Edge aceita o uso da indicação de nome do servidor na borda sul (do processador de mensagens aos endpoints de destino). Se você quiser usar a SNI, entre em contato com o suporte da Apigee.

O Java 1.7 é obrigatório.

Com a SNI, que é uma extensão do TLS/SSL, vários destinos HTTPS podem ser atendidos pelo mesmo endereço IP e porta, sem exigir que todos esses destinos usem o mesmo certificado.

Nenhuma configuração específica do Edge é necessária. Se o ambiente estiver configurado para SNI de borda sul (a nuvem do Edge é por padrão), ele é compatível.

O Edge extrai automaticamente o hostname do URL da solicitação e o adiciona à solicitação de handshake do SSL. Por exemplo, se o host de destino for https://example.com/request/path, o Edge adicionará a extensão server_name conforme mostrado abaixo:

Para mais informações sobre a SNI, consulte http://en.wikipedia.org/wiki/Server_Name_Indication.

Acesso à comunidade da Apigee no menu de ajuda da IU de gerenciamento

É possível acessar a comunidade da Apigee no menu de ajuda da IU de gerenciamento.

Política de controle de acesso

A política de controle de acesso foi aprimorada para permitir uma avaliação mais refinada de endereços IP para inclusão na lista de permissões e proibições quando os endereços IP estiverem contidos no cabeçalho HTTP X-FORWARDED-FOR.

Com a verificação de vários endereços IP ativada no cabeçalho (entre em contato com o suporte para definir o feature.enableMultipleXForwardCheckForACL), um novo elemento <ValidateBasedOn> na política permite verificar o primeiro IP, o último IP ou todos os IPs no cabeçalho. Para mais informações, consulte Política de controle de acesso.

Mensagens de erro da IU de gerenciamento

A exibição da mensagem de erro na IU de gerenciamento foi reformulada.

Novas variáveis de destino no fluxo de mensagens

Novas variáveis nos fluxos de mensagens fornecem informações de URL mais completas para endpoints e servidores de destino:

  • TargetEndpoint: request.url substitui target.basepath.with.query.
  • TargetServer: loadbalancing.targetserver substitui targetserver.name. Além disso, target.basepath só é preenchido quando o elemento <Path> é usado no elemento <LoadBalancer> HTTPTargetConnection do TargetEndpoint.

"Algoritmo de assinatura" nos detalhes dos certificados SSL

Um novo campo "Signature Algorithm" foi adicionado aos detalhes do certificado SSL, visível na IU de gerenciamento (Administrador > Certificados SSL) e na API de gerenciamento (Ver detalhes do certificado de um keystore ou Truststore). O campo mostra "sha1WithRSAEncryption" ou "sha256WithRSAEncryption", dependendo do tipo de algoritmo de hash usado para gerar o certificado.

Bugs corrigidos

Os bugs abaixo foram corrigidos nesta versão.

Id do problema Descrição
MGMT-1899 Caminhos de recursos excluídos após salvar as configurações do produto
Ao editar um produto de API, os caminhos de recursos do produto podem ser excluídos se o usuário clicar duas vezes no botão "Salvar". Esse problema foi corrigido.
MGMT-1894 A página "Apps do desenvolvedor" nunca termina de carregar para a coluna do desenvolvedor
MGMT-1882 O novo proxy de API da WSDL mostra somente os detalhes do último parâmetro
MGMT-1878 Se várias revisões forem implantadas em um ambiente, o Trace mostrará apenas uma delas
MGMT-1872 Não é possível fazer o download de relatórios personalizados
MGMT-1863 Registros do Node.js não visíveis na IU de gerenciamento
MGMT-1825 Bugs de scripting em vários locais (XSS)
MGMT-1804 A API Node.js está enviando JSON inválido em alguns casos
MGMT-1799 Solicitação de envio de vulnerabilidade de segurança da IU no Trace
MGMT-1362 O e-mail "Esqueci a senha" não funciona quando o endereço de e-mail contém "_".
DEVRT-1514 Quebras de ObjectTransform para alguns produtos
APIRT-1170 O arquivo de recurso ausente causou uma falha ao carregar um ambiente no MP